Since legendary duelist ancient millennium, where toons only got 2 reprints in the set, toons haven't received new support in a long time. It would be neat to see more nostalgic cards based on classic anime cards. 

 

( one thing I don’t write on the cards is specifying manga ryu-ran, who has received an errata saying it’s always a toon card, as shown on the database / wikia )

 

Toon Celtic Guardian

Level 4 / Earth / Warrior / Toon / Effect

1400 attack / 1200 defense

 

Cannot attack the turn it is Summoned. While you control “Toon World” and your opponent controls no Toon monsters, this card can attack your opponent directly. If this card inflicts battle damage to your opponent: you can add 1 “Toon” card from your graveyard to your hand.

 

Toon Legendary Fisherman

Level 5 / Water / Warrior / Toon / Effect

1850 attack / 1600 defense

 

Cannot attack the turn it is Summoned. While you control “Toon World” and your opponent controls no Toon monsters, this card can attack your opponent directly. While “Toon World” is on the field, you can normal summon this card without tributing. While “Toon World” is on the field this card is unaffected by spell effects that are not “Toon” spell cards you control and cannot be targeted for attacks.

 

Toon Jinzo

Level 6 / Dark / Machine / Toon / Effect

2400 attack / 1500 defense

 

Cannot attack the turn it is Summoned. While you control “Toon World” and your opponent controls no Toon monsters, this card can attack your opponent directly. Trap cards your opponent controls, and their effects on your opponent’s field, cannot be activated. Negate all trap card effects your opponent controls on their field.

 

Toon Flame Swordsman

Level 6 / Fire / Warrior / Toon / Effect

1800 attack / 1600 defense

 

Cannot attack the turn it is Summoned. While you control “Toon World” and your opponent controls no Toon monsters, this card can attack your opponent directly. While “Toon World” is on the field you can normal summon this card without tributing. When this card inflicts damage to your opponent: destroy 1 card your opponent controls.

 

Toon Catapult

Trap - Continuous

 

Once per turn: You can tribute 1 Toon monster in your hand or on your field; special summon 1 Toon monster other than the tributed monster from your graveyard or deck ignoring it’s summoning conditions. If you control “Toon World” Toon monsters you control can attack during the turn they are summoned, but if you attack this way, you must pay 500 lifepoints to declare an attack with those Toon monsters, also if you opponent controls a Toon monsters, they must target that Toon monster for their attacks. These effects do not apply if they were summoned during a different turn that they attacked.

I like the Normal Summon without Tributing mechanic on your higher Level monsters, and Toon Catapult is a really good card, even with OPT or HOPT, of which it is missing both (right now it can cycle through all your toons in your Deck without restriction), but the rest of the set is underwhelming. Toon Mirror Shield is a little helpful for defending, when you don't want to take damage even with Toon Kingdom, however, considering the main mechanic of Toons is attacking directly, it kinda renders that void. Your other monsters are decent techs, I guess, but at the moments Toons such because of how slow they are, both at getting out their monsters and actually using them, even with their current consistency cards. This support fixes none of that, despite how well you have Toonified some monsters.
